Substance of response states: " I can neither confirm nor deny that the information you require is held by Northumbria Police as to actually determine if it is held would exceed the permitted 18 hours therefore Section 12(2) of the Freedom of Information Act would apply. This section does not oblige a public authority to comply with a request for information if the authority estimated that the cost of complying with the request would exceed the appropriate limit of 18 hours, equating to £450.00 You should consider this to be a refusal notice under Section 17 of the Act for your request. I have set out the reasons for this below. To even begin to determine if any information was held would require a manual trail of every record on every system over the last 5 years to establish if information was held relevant to the request. Due to the number of systems and the volume of information which would require review, S12(2) is relevant. Additionally, such information may be held in physical records and again such a search would be of such a size, we cannot begin to estimate how long it would take. You should note that had S12(2) not been applicable S40 (5) Personal Information would have been applicable." If you are the requester, then you may sign in to view the message. The response states: "I have reviewed your application and I note that you ask for the number of living individuals with the name W Hunter or W hunter including an initial where present on Northumbria Police records. It does not specify in what capacity that may be, so this could relate to a suspect, a victim, a witness, an enquiry recorded by an individual with that name including a serving or ex Police Officer or member of Police staff held within HR records. Due to the breadth of records covered by the request, the exemption that has been applied is Section 12 (2). In conclusion, it is the decision of this review that the original response provided to you was entirely appropriate and that the application of Section 12(2) was properly assessed and justified."
